00001 
00002 
00003 
00004 
00005 
00006 
00007 
00008 
00009 #ifndef AMROC_V3VISUALGRIDBASE_H
00010 #define AMROC_V3VISUALGRIDBASE_H
00011 
00019 #include "VisualGridBase.h"
00020 
00027 class V3VisualGridBase : public VisualGridBase {
00028 public:
00029   V3VisualGridBase(EvaluatorBase* ev) : VisualGridBase(ev) {}
00030 
00031   virtual void SetGrid(float xyz[][3]) {}
00032   virtual void SetScal(int *key,float v[]) {}
00033   virtual void Vect(int *key,float v[][3]) {}
00034   virtual void FindNodePairs() {}
00035   virtual void SetNodePairs(int listequiv[][2]) {}
00036   virtual int NFacetsOnSurface() { return xlc_idummy; }   
00037   virtual void SetSurfaces(int nsurf[][2], int surf[], int scel[][4],
00038                            char tsurf[][20]) {}
00039   virtual void Draw3D() {}
00040   virtual const int& Equiv() const { return xlc_idummy; }
00041   virtual int Kequiv() const { return xlc_idummy; }
00042 };
00043 
00044 #endif